Altera Video and Image Processing Suite User Manual

Page 189

Advertising
background image

Address

Register

RO/RW

Description

25

Motion Shift

RW

Specifies the amount of raw motion (SAD) data that is

right-shifted. Shifting is used to reduce sensitivity to

noise when calculating motion (SAD) data for both

bob and weave decisions and cadence detection.
Note: It is very important to set this register

correctly for good deinterlacing perform‐

ance.

Tune this register in conjunction with the motion

visualization feature. Higher values decrease sensitivity

to noise when calculating motion, but may start to

introduce weave artefacts if the value used is too high.
To improve video-over-film mode quality, consider

using software to check the

3:2 Cadence State (VOF

State)

register, and to add one or two to the motion

shift register's value when deinterlacing cadenced

content.
Range: 0–7
Power on value: 4

26

Visualize Film

Pixels

RW

Specifies the film pixels in the current field to be

colored green for debugging purposes. Use this register

in conjunction with the various VOF tuning registers.
Range: 0–1
Power on value: 0

27

Visualize Motion

Values€

RW

Specifies the motion values for pixels represented with

pink for debugging purposes. The greater the

luminance of pink, the more motion is detected.
Range: 0–1
Power on value: 0

Design Guidelines for Broadcast Deinterlacer IP Core

The Broadcast Deinterlacer has a comprehensive set of CSR registers that allow precise tuning of the

deinterlaced output. The exact register values used depend on the end system.

12-30

Design Guidelines for Broadcast Deinterlacer IP Core

UG-VIPSUITE

2015.05.04

Altera Corporation

Deinterlacing IP Cores

Send Feedback

Advertising